Effects of resistance training associated with whey protein supplementation on liver and kidney biomarkers in rats.

Abstract

The aim of this study was to investigate the impact of whey protein (WP) supplementation and resistance training (RT) on liver and kidney biomarkers. The sedentary + WP group showed higher levels of plasma liver and kidney dysfunction markers compared with the other groups. In addition, WP supplementation associated with RT resulted in physiologic cardiac hypertrophy. WP supplementation without RT affected liver and kidney function.
